无论是社交媒体上的动态分享、电商平台的商品展示,还是新闻网站的图文并茂报道,图片都扮演着至关重要的角色
然而,随着用户量级的激增和图片数据的海量增长,如何高效、快速地传输这些图片资源,成为了摆在互联网服务提供商面前的一大挑战
此时,图片服务器CDN(内容分发网络)凭借其强大的分发能力和优化策略,成为了加速互联网视觉体验的关键引擎
一、图片服务器CDN的基本概念与工作原理 图片服务器CDN,简而言之,是一种通过在全球范围内部署多个节点服务器,将图片资源缓存到离用户最近的服务器上,从而实现图片的快速加载和传输的技术
其核心在于“分发”与“缓存”两大机制
分发机制 当用户请求一张图片时,CDN系统首先会根据用户的地理位置、网络状况等因素,智能地选择一个最优的节点服务器来响应用户的请求
这一过程依赖于复杂的路由算法和实时的网络监控,确保每一次请求都能得到最快速的响应
缓存机制 在分发的过程中,CDN节点服务器会缓存用户请求的图片资源
这意味着,当相同或相似的请求再次发生时,可以直接从缓存中读取数据,而无需再次从源服务器获取,从而极大地缩短了响应时间
同时,CDN系统还会根据图片的访问频率、更新时间等因素,动态调整缓存策略,以保持缓存内容的新鲜度和有效性
二、图片服务器CDN的优势分析 1. 提升加载速度,优化用户体验 对于网站或应用而言,图片的加载速度直接影响到用户的体验和满意度
CDN通过减少数据传输的距离和延迟,使得图片资源能够以前所未有的速度呈现给用户
这不仅提升了页面的整体加载速度,还减少了用户的等待时间,从而提高了用户的留存率和转化率
2. 降低带宽成本,提升经济效益 对于内容提供商来说,使用CDN可以有效降低带宽成本
由于CDN节点服务器能够缓存并分发大量的图片资源,减少了源服务器的负载和带宽消耗,进而降低了运营商的运营成本
同时,CDN还能根据用户的访问模式和流量峰值进行智能调度,实现资源的优化配置,进一步提升经济效益
3. 增强安全性与稳定性 CDN不仅加速了图片的传输,还为其提供了额外的安全保护
通过部署防火墙、DDoS攻击防护等安全措施,CDN能够有效抵御各种网络攻击,保障图片资源的稳定传输
此外,CDN的分布式架构也增强了系统的容错性和可用性,即使某个节点出现故障,也能迅速切换到其他节点继续提供服务
4. 支持动态内容与个性化定制 虽然CDN主要用于静态资源的分发,但现代CDN技术已经能够支持动态内容的缓存和分发
对于需要频繁更新的图片资源,如电商平台的促销海报、新闻网站的实时图片等,CDN可以通过智能缓存策略和版本控制机制,确保用户始终能够获取到最新的内容
同时,CDN还支持基于用户画像的个性化定制,为不同用户提供更加精准和贴心的服务
三、图片服务器CDN的应用场景与案例分析 社交媒体 在社